Takeda Deploys AI Across 14 Drug Programs, Cuts Submission Time 97%

Pharmaceutical giant partners with Weave Bio to automate regulatory workflows as agencies clarify AI oversight standards.

Takeda scales AI regulatory automation across global pipeline

Takeda has deployed Weave Bio's artificial intelligence platform across 14 active drug development programs spanning multiple international markets, marking one of the pharmaceutical industry's most extensive implementations of AI-driven regulatory automation to date.

The collaboration centers on integrating Weave Bio's AI tools into Takeda's regulatory operations to accelerate submission preparation and streamline interactions with health authorities. According to Pharmaceutical Technology, which first reported the partnership details, the initiative initially focused on investigational new drug (IND) submissions before expanding to handle health authority questions (HAQ) and response-to-question (RTQ) workflows.

A joint research paper authored by scientists from both organizations documented results from the IND phase: the AI system reduced initial submission drafting time by 97% in the evaluated use case, compressing what traditionally required approximately 100 hours of work into just three hours.

For HAQ and RTQ processes, the platform processed more than 100 regulatory questions in the assessed dataset without recording extraction errors. The system achieved an average AI answer quality score of 68%, exceeding the collaboration's target range of 50% to 70%.

Why it matters

This deployment arrives as global regulatory agencies establish formal frameworks for AI use in pharmaceutical development. The timing positions Takeda to demonstrate compliance with emerging standards while potentially gaining speed advantages in bringing therapies to market. For an industry where regulatory timelines directly impact patient access and commercial returns, validated AI tools that maintain quality while compressing preparation cycles represent significant operational value.

Regulatory oversight framework takes shape

The partnership's structure reflects evolving regulatory expectations around AI deployment. Takeda's chief regulatory officer and global regulatory affairs head, Nahid Latif, emphasized that regulatory professionals retain ultimate responsibility for content verification and final decision-making despite the AI assistance.

This human-oversight model aligns with recent guidance from major agencies. The U.S. Food and Drug Administration published draft guidance on AI in regulatory decision-making in January 2025, followed by joint principles issued with the European Medicines Agency in January 2026. Both Takeda and Weave Bio indicate their approach supports these regulatory frameworks.

Latif stated that Takeda aims to lead in responsible AI application across research and development operations, enabling teams to work more effectively while accelerating medicine delivery to patients.

The collaboration represents a concrete example of pharmaceutical companies moving beyond pilot projects to operational-scale AI integration in regulatory functions—a shift that could reshape industry timelines if the quality and efficiency gains prove consistent across broader application.
